Quentin Scott is a 6'7", 215 -pound versatile Guard/Forward with proven high-level scoring ability and production across multiple seasons in The Basketball League and the 94x50 League. Scott combines size, athleticism, scoring versatility, rebounding ability, and playmaking to impact the game on multiple levels.
SCOUTING PROFILE
Size & Position
At 6'7", 215 pounds, Scott possesses the physical profile of a modern professional wing.
His size allows him to operate as both a guard and forward, providing lineup flexibility and matchup versatility.
Scoring
Scott's greatest statistical calling card is his ability to consistently produce points. His 30.0 PPG in 2025 led the TBL, establishing him as an elite offensive producer at the league level. During the 2025 season, Scott had a season high of 60pts and 11rbs to lead his team in an overtime win.
He followed that campaign with another highly productive season in 2026, averaging 22.3 PPG while shooting 47.3% from the field. During the 2026 season, Scott recorded a season high of 41 pts and 10 rbs on 72.7% fg, 57.1% 3pt, 83.3% ft.
Rebounding
Scott averaged 8.2 RPG in 2025 and 6.2 RPG in 2026, giving his team significant rebounding production from the wing position.
In 2025, Scott recorded 8 games with a double double, and had a season high of 28pts and 17rbs.
Playmaking
With 4.0 APG in 2025 and 3.0 APG in 2026, Scott demonstrates the ability to create opportunities for teammates while carrying a significant scoring responsibility.
Shooting
Scott shot 46.1% from the field in 2025, improving to 47.3% in 2026. He also shot 81.0% from the free-throw line in 2025.

Basketball Experience:
2026: Frederick FC, 94x50 Basketball League
22.3 PPG | 6.2 RPG | 3.0 APG | 47.3 FG% | 33.0 3PT% | 76.0 FT%
3rd Leading Scorer in 94x50 League
Season High: 41pts 10 rbs - 72.7% fg, 57.1% 3pt, 83.3% ft (5/24/2026)
2025: Virginia Valley Vipers, TBL Basketball League
30.0 PPG | 8.2 RPG | 4.0 APG | 1.8 steals | 46.1 FG% | 30.0 3PT% | 81.0 FT%
TBL Leading Scorer - TBL All-Star - 1st Team All TBL
Season High: 60 pts, 11 rbs, 5 ast, 4 steals (4/13/2025)
2024:Virginia Valley Vipers, TBL Basketball League
23.4 PPG | 8.6 RPG | 2.4 APG | 1.3 steals
TBL All-Star - 1st Team All TBL
2024: Frederick FC, TBL Basketball League
2023-24: Virginia Valley Vipers, BSL League
2021-22: Tulane University NCAA D1, American Conference
2017-18 through 2020-21: Texas St. University NCAA D1, Sun Belt Conference
